linux, git, go get, dept_tools 代理设置

高性能计算
• 阅读 3061

linux 设置代理

# 设置环境变量 
# 其实不写入 /etc/profile 或 ~/.bash_profile
# 和设置临时变量没什么区别
export http_proxy=http://127.0.0.1:8100
export https_proxy=http://127.0.0.1:8100

# 查看
echo $http_proxy
echo $https_proxy

# 取消代理
unset http_proxy
unset https_proxy

git 设置代理

git 代理会先检查有无系统代理,如果系统配置了 http_proxy / https_proxy,git 也会使用代理配置。

# 设置ss
git config --global http.proxy 'socks5://127.0.0.1:8100'
git config --global https.proxy 'socks5://127.0.0.1:8100'

# 设置代理
git config --global https.proxy http://127.0.0.1:8100
git config --global https.proxy https://127.0.0.1:8100

# 取消代理
git config --global --unset http.proxy
git config --global --unset https.proxy

go get 设置代理

go get 使用的拉取工具就是 git,所以设置 git 的代理即可。

dept_tools 代理设置

dept_tools 是 google 的依赖管理工具,fetch 命令实质是调用的 python 拉取依赖,所以 dept_tools 的代理应使用 boto.cfg 配置。

# /etc/boto.cfg
[Boto]
debug = 1
num_retries = 2

# 代理 ip / 端口 (这是我的本地代理)
proxy = 127.0.0.1
proxy_port = 8100

linux, git, go get, dept_tools 代理设置

win 环境变量

windows 设置,查看,删除环境变量

#设置
set CGO_ENABLE=0
set GO_ARCH=amd64

# 查看
set CGO_ENABLE
set GO_ARCH

# 删除
set CGO_ENABLE=
set GO_ARCH=

# 设置 PATH
set PATH=%PATH%;c:/bin/hello
点赞
收藏
评论区
推荐文章
科工人 科工人
4年前
go mod环境搭建
前言gomod是golang最新的模块依赖管理的工具,推荐使用。go1.11通过设置环境变量GO111MODULE来决定是否启用go1.13已经默认支持,以下以1.13为例配置环境变量exportGOPROXY或exportGOPROXYexportGOPATH"/Users/XXX
Stella981 Stella981
4年前
Linux下基本环境搭建
1. 安装JDK1.上传jdk7u45linuxx64.tar.gz到Linux上2.解压jdk到/usr/local目录tarzxvfjdk7u45linuxx64.tar.gzC/usr/local/3.设置环境变量,在/etc/profile文件最后追加相关内容vi/etc
Stella981 Stella981
4年前
Golang学习之GOROOT、PATH、GOPATH及go get
1\.GOROOTGOPATH及PATH设置a.添加系统变量GOROOT:安装完Go第一件事就是设置GOROOT。例如我的Go安装在C:\\Go目录,则要设置GOROOTC:\\Gob.修改环境变量PATH:将%GOROOT%\\bin加到环境变量PATH里面,这样就可以直接在dos命令模式下任意目录运行%GOROO
Wesley13 Wesley13
4年前
Linux的环境变量配置
Linux下设置变量有三种方法:第一种:在/etc/profile文件中添加变量【对所有用户生效(永久的)】  用VI在文件/etc/profile文件中增加变量,该变量将会对Linux下所有用户有效,并且是“永久的”。  例如:编辑/etc/profile文件,添加CLASSPATH变量  vi/etc/profile  
Stella981 Stella981
4年前
Gradle插件Debug
设置环境变量unix,linux   exportGRADLE\_OPTS"XdebugXrunjdwp:transportdt\_socket,address9999,servery,suspendn”windows    setGRADLE\_OPTS"XdebugXrunjdwp:tra
Wesley13 Wesley13
4年前
.bash_profile和.bashrc的区别
Linux下环境变量配置方法梳理(.bash\_profile和.bashrc的区别) 在linux系统下,如果下载并安装了应用程序,在启动时很有可能在键入它的名称时出现"commandnotfound"的提示内容。如果每次都到安装目标文件夹内,找到可执行文件_来进行操作就太繁琐了,这种情况下就涉及到环境变量PATH的设置问题,而PATH的设置也
Stella981 Stella981
4年前
Hbase基本操作及单机配置
1.安装单机版hbase1.25下载hbase(http://apache.fayea.com/hbase/)2.解压hbaseTarzxvf\\\.tar.gzMv\\\/opt3.设置环境变量Vim/etc/profile添加exportPATH$PATH:/opt/hbase1.2.5/bin
Wesley13 Wesley13
4年前
Java 环境变量配置及其作用
在java中需要设置三个环境变量(1.5之后不用再设置classpath了,但个人建议继续设置以保证向下兼用问题)JDK安装完成之后我们来设置环境变量:右击“我的电脑”,选择“属性”,选择“高级”标签,进入环境变量设置,分别设置如下环境变量:(1)直接配置path变量:  为什么要配置path变量?    因为电脑系统将根据该变量的值找到java编
Stella981 Stella981
4年前
Shell运行环境之环境变量
在Windows系统中,我们经常需要设置环境变量,特别是安装完JavaJDK之后。而在Linux里面也是需要对一些环境变量进行设置,比如PATH(执行文件的路径),http\_proxy(http代理)等。本文主要介绍三种环境变量临时变量,用户变量和系统变量,并对其作用的先后做一些验证。简介环境变量(https://
Wesley13 Wesley13
4年前
Ubuntu 环境变量
环境变量配置文件在Ubuntu中有如下几个文件可以设置环境变量1、/etc/profile:在登录时,操作系统定制用户环境时使用的第一个文件,此文件为系统的每个用户设置环境信息,当用户第一次登录时,该文件被执行。2、/etc/environment:在登录时操作系统使用的第二个文件,系统在读取你自己的prof